Climate Overview
The climate in Nghĩa Lộ is warm and mild. The average annual temperature is 20°C and approximately 3113mm of precipitation falls per year. Nghĩa Lộ receives a notable amount of rainfall throughout the year, including during its driest month. Nghĩa Lộ is in the Northern Hemisphere. Summer begins at the end of June and lasts through September. The summer months are: June, July, August. The coldest months are December, February, January, when temperatures can drop to 11°C.
Temperature
Nghĩa Lộ sees moderate temperature variation throughout the year, ranging from 11°C to 28°C. The warmest month is June, when average highs reach 28°C and the mean temperature sits around 25°C. December is the coolest month, with minimum temperatures around 11°C and an average of 14°C. Daily temperature variation is modest, with an average difference of 6°C between highs and lows. The sharpest temperature change occurs between November and December, with a 4°C shift in average temperatures.
Precipitation
Nghĩa Lộ is a very wet location, receiving approximately 3113mm of precipitation annually, which averages out to around 259mm per month. The wettest month is August, averaging 615mm of rainfall. July and June also tend to see above-average precipitation. The driest month is February, with just 70mm. That's 545mm less than August, the wettest month. Rainfall is heavily concentrated in certain months, creating a distinct wet and dry season. Visitors should plan around these patterns, as the difference between peak and low months is dramatic.

Spring
Temperatures range from 15 to 27°C. Rainfall is heavy, totalling around 793mm across the season with a monthly average of 264mm. Winds are generally light, averaging 1km/h. An umbrella or waterproof jacket is advisable as spring showers are frequent.
Summer
Temperatures range from 22 to 28°C. Rainfall is heavy, totalling around 1436mm across the season with a monthly average of 479mm. Winds are generally light, averaging 1km/h. Light, breathable clothing is ideal — perfect conditions for outdoor activities.
Autumn
Temperatures range from 15 to 26°C. Rainfall is heavy, totalling around 599mm across the season with a monthly average of 200mm. Winds are generally light, averaging 1km/h. A waterproof jacket and sturdy footwear are recommended as rain becomes more frequent.
Winter
Temperatures range from 11 to 18°C. Precipitation is moderate at around 285mm for the season, averaging 95mm per month. Winds are generally light, averaging 1km/h. A light jacket or sweater is usually sufficient, though cooler evenings may call for an extra layer.
